在客户端做java开发(有javac命令,jre没有),必须安装jdk,如果在服务器端运行java程序,则不需要jdk,安装jre(java 运行环境)即可。
安装方式有两种:
1、安装rpm包,可以自己去官网下载,也可以使用yum安装;
2、下载tar包,解压、配置环境变量即可。
jdk下载地址:
jre下载地址:
3.解压后把解压的jdk目录复制到usr/java/目录下:
mv /opt/jdk-1.8/ /usr/java/
[mcbadm@sec-awareness01 ~]$ ll /usr/java/
total 25916
drwxr-xr-x 2 mcbadm mcb 4096 Sep 23 07:24 bin
-r--r--r-- 1 mcbadm mcb 3244 Sep 23 07:23 COPYRIGHT
drwxr-xr-x 4 mcbadm mcb 4096 Sep 23 07:23 db
drwxr-xr-x 3 mcbadm mcb 4096 Sep 23 07:23 include
-rwxr-xr-x 1 mcbadm mcb 5091318 Sep 23 03:20 javafx-src.zip
drwxr-xr-x 5 mcbadm mcb 4096 Sep 23 07:24 jre
drwxr-xr-x 5 mcbadm mcb 4096 Sep 23 07:24 lib
-r--r--r-- 1 mcbadm mcb 40 Sep 23 07:23 LICENSE
drwxr-xr-x 4 mcbadm mcb 4096 Sep 23 07:23 man
-r--r--r-- 1 mcbadm mcb 159 Sep 23 07:23 README.html
-rw-r--r-- 1 mcbadm mcb 526 Sep 23 07:23 release
-rw-r--r-- 1 mcbadm mcb 21111126 Sep 23 07:23 src.zip
-rwxr-xr-x 1 mcbadm mcb 110114 Sep 23 03:20 THIRDPARTYLICENSEREADME-JAVAFX.txt
-r--r--r-- 1 mcbadm mcb 177094 Sep 23 07:23 THIRDPARTYLICENSEREADME.txt
[mcbadm@sec-awareness01 ~]$
5.配置环境变量
[mcbadm@sec-awareness01 conf]$ cat ~/.bash_profile
# .bash_profile
# Get the aliases and functions
if [ -f ~/.bashrc ]; then
. ~/.bashrc
fi
# User specific environment and startup programs
export JAVA_HOME=/usr/java/
export JRE_HOME=$JAVA_HOME/jre/
PATH=$PATH:$HOME/bin:/opt/ssa_web/apache-tomcat-8.0.24/bin:$JAVA_HOME/bin/:$JRE_HOME/bin/
export PATH
TOMCAT_HOME=/opt/ssa_web/apache-tomcat-8.0.24/
[mcbadm@sec-awareness01 conf]$
###############################################################
经常服务器上已经安装openjdk,通过yum或者预装系统的时候,安装的rmp包。
执行java -version可以查看,也可以whereis java ,which java,javac查看相关路径。有时候有jre没有jdk的话,就没有javac。
默认安装路径:/usr/lib/jvm/java-1.7.0-openjdk-1.7.0.65.x86_64/,该目录下有bin,有jre目录。
阅读(1219) | 评论(1) | 转发(0) |